## Device Story

Sentinel Clin Chem Cal is a lyophilized, human serum-based calibrator; used to calibrate clinical chemistry assays on automated systems (e.g., Abbott ARCHITECT c8000). The device provides reference values for pancreatic amylase, cholinesterase, creatinine, lithium, and alpha-hydroxybutyrate dehydrogenase. The calibrator is reconstituted by the laboratory technician and processed alongside controls and master lots to establish target values. By ensuring accurate calibration, the device enables clinical chemistry analyzers to provide precise quantitative results for patient samples, supporting diagnostic decision-making by healthcare providers.

## Clinical Evidence

No clinical data. Bench testing only. Performance supported by traceability to NIST SRM909b, DGKC, and IFCC standards. Stability testing confirms 24-month shelf life and 2-day reconstituted stability at 2-8°C (or 14 days at -20°C). Value assignment performed in-house on clinical chemistry analyzers using triplicate testing across four runs; imprecision maintained below 4.5%.

## Technological Characteristics

Lyophilized human serum-based calibrator. Traceable to NIST SRM909b, DGKC/37°C, and IFCC EPS/37°C standards. Storage: 2-8°C. Analyzers: Abbott Aeroset and Abbott Architect. No software or electronic connectivity.

## Regulatory Identification

A calibrator is a device intended for medical purposes for use in a test system to establish points of reference that are used in the determination of values in the measurement of substances in human specimens. (See also § 862.2 in this part.)

I. Device Description:
The Sentinel Clin Chem Cal is an in vitro diagnostic device intended for use in pancreatic amylase, cholinesterase, creatinine, lithium, alpha-hydroxybutyrate dehydrogenase and “cholinesterase dibucaine-inhibited” assays to establish points of reference that are used in the determination of values in the measurement of pancreatic amylase, cholinesterase, creatinine, lithium, alpha-hydroxybutyrate dehydrogenase and “cholinesterase dibucaine-inhibited” in human specimens. The device consists of lyophilized material in human based serum. The human serum used has been tested and found to be non-reactive for HBsAg, anti-HIV 1/2 and anti-HCV.

c. Traceability, Stability, Expected values (controls, calibrators, or methods):

The Sentinel Clin Chem Cal is traceable to the following:

|  Analytes | Method | Standardization  |
| --- | --- | --- |
|  Cholinesterase | Deutsche Gesellschaft fur Kinische Chemie (DGKC) Butyrylthiocholine 37° | ε Hexacyano-ferrate (III)  |
|  Cholinesterase Dibucaine-Inhibited | Deutsche Gesellschaft fur Kinische Chemie (DGKC) Dibucaine.inhibited liquid | ε Hexacyano-ferrate (III)  |
|  Pancreatic Amylase | International Federation of Clinical Chemistry (IFCC) EPS / 37° | p-Nitrophenol  |
|  Creatinine | Enzymatic Colorimetric | NIST, SRM909b  |
|  Lithium | Colorimetric Substituted Porphyrin | NIST, SRM909b  |
|  Alpha-hydroxybutyrate dehydrogenase | DGKC/37° | ε NADH  |

Values are assigned in-house on commercially marketed clinical chemistry analyzers. Each testing run evaluates triplicates of the following: two levels of control materials (low and high), an aliquot of internal master lot and two aliquots of two pools of calibrator materials. Four runs on at least two different days are performed. The mean and the standard deviation of the two calibrator pools were calculated. The assigned value was determined to be the mean of the two calibrator pools barring any outlier and imprecision of less than 4.5%.

The sponsors' results support the shelf-life stability claim of up to 24 month and a reconstituted stability material claim of 2 days at 2 to 8°C or 14 days at -20°C when stored in small volumes and frozen once.
